Kresge Library Print Collection Update
The Kresge print collection has been permanently removed from the Kresge building to prepare for construction.
Many of the books, nearly 55,000 items, have made the short journey up Tappan to their new home at the University Library. These print collection items (including books, bound journals, and microfilm) were moved during the week of July 14 to a temporary storage facility. We anticipate that these items will be searchable in Mirlyn later in 2014 when they incorporated into the University Library collection.
Books not selected by the University Library (primarily duplicate copies of works) were sent to Better World Books to either be sold, donated or recycled.

Construction Update - Kresge Library Building Closed
With the handing over of the Kresge building to the contractors, the building will be closed as of Monday, July 21 for the duration of the construction.
The Kresge Library Services staff are housed in the Modular Offices near the front entrance to Ross and still available to answer your questions. You can contact us via our Contact Us form or send us an email at kresge_library@umich.edu.
